In the Small Magellanic Cloud, a massive star explodes as a supernova.


The Small Magellanic Cloud, a dwarf galaxy located 210,000 light-years away from the Milky Way, is visible in the Southern Hemisphere, in the direction of the constellation Tucana.  A cosmic explosion image, taken by the NASA Hubble Space Telescope, shows that in the Small Magellanic Cloud, a massive star exploded as a supernova, and its interior began to expand.

The E0102 supernova, determined to be only 2,000 years old, relatively young on astronomical scales, was observed in 2003 with the Hubble Advanced Camera for Surveys. Hubble's four filters that separated light from blue, visible and infrared wavelengths and hydrogen emission were combined with oxygen emission images of the SNR taken with the Wide Field Planetary Camera 2 in 1995.

E0102 is one such young supernova, allowing researchers to directly probe material from the cores of massive stars.  E0102 provides insight into how stars form, and the growth of chemical matter in their composition and surrounding region. NASA's Spitzer Space Telescope will be closed.

NASA briefly informed that the Spitzer Space Telescope will be permanently discontinued on January 30, 2020.
